Noooo galloways are also equids between 14 and 15 hands.

I think it's a much nicer name for that height range than the one that I think they use over there in hunters (I think?) - 'hony' or something? Blech! Galloways are a lovely stepping stone for older kids/teenagers before they go onto a horse. Pony dressage is taking off here but while it's called 'pony' as I said earlier the max height is nearly 14.3 and most ponies internationally specifically bred to be sports ponies (ie German and Dutch Riding Ponies) are right up to height (if not over).
